Alibaba Health is the flagship healthcare platform of Alibaba Group Holding. Through two direct online stores, it sells prescription and over-the-counter medications, health supplements and skincare products to customers, who can also access its online consultation service. The company was formerly known as Citic 21CN, a drug data services company. In 2014, Alibaba and a Chinese private equity firm co-founded by Alibaba founder Jack Ma bought a controlling stake in Citic 21CN and changed its name. Alibaba also owns the South China Morning Post.
